我这里准备三台机器192.168.3.179master192.168.3.176slave192.168.3.177slave1、master配置:/bin/jmeter.properties,其它的相同参数注释掉,第三个参数是命令行启动时每几秒打印一次,最低6秒修改jmeter-server2、slave配置jmeter.propertiesjmeter-server配置三台机器的jmeter版本都要一致,最好拿主机的jmeter,拷贝两份给salve3、两台slave执行:./jmeter-server显示这个就说明启动成功了,接下来去master执行压测4、我是用GUI来执行的,sta
1.设置用户信息gitconfig--globaluser.name"itcast"gitconfig--globaluser.email"hello@itcast.cn"(邮箱没有什么用,我这里就简单写了)2.查看配置信息gitconfig--globaluser.name gitconfig--globaluser.email3.为常用指令配置别名(可以选修)有些常用的指令参数非常多,每次都要输入好多参数,我们可以使用别名。1.打开用户目录,创建.bashrc文件 部分windows系统不允许用户创建点号开头的文件,可以打开gitBash,执行touch~/.bashrc。2.在.ba
以M5AtomS3为例,博客撰写效率提升10倍以上:0. Linux环境ArduinoIDE中配置ATOMS3_zhangrelay的博客-CSDN博客1. M5ATOMS3基础01按键_zhangrelay的博客-CSDN博客2. M5ATOMS3基础02传感器MPU6886_zhangrelay的博客-CSDN博客3. M5ATOMS3基础03给ROS1发一个问候(rosserial)_zhangrelay的博客-CSDN博客4. M5ATOMS3基础04给ROS2发一个问候(micro-ROS)_zhangrelay的博客-CSDN博客基础内容嵌入式通常就是接口IO,input/outp
分布式搜索ES11.分布式搜索ESa.介绍ESb.IK分词器c.索引库操作(类似于MYSQL的Table)d.查看、删除、修改索引库e.文档操作(类似MYSQL的数据)1)添加文档2)查看文档3)删除文档4)修改文档f.RestClient操作索引库1)创建索引库2)删除索引库/判断索引库g.RestClient操作文档1)新增文档2)查询文档3)修改文档4)删除文档5)批量导入数据到ESh.DSL查询文档1)查询所有2)全文检索查询3)精确查询4)地理查询5)复合查询1)FunctionScoreQuery2)BooleanQueryi.DSL搜索结果处理1)排序2)分页3)高亮j.Rest
当我听说Java8中的parallelStream()时,我很高兴,它在多个内核上处理并最终在单个JVM中返回结果。没有更多的多线程代码行。据我了解,这仅对单个JVM有效。但是,如果我想将处理分布到单个主机甚至多个主机上的不同JVM上怎么办?Java8是否包含任何用于简化它的抽象?在tutorialatdreamsyssoft.com中用户列表privatestaticListusers=Arrays.asList(newUser(1,"Steve","Vai",40),newUser(4,"Joe","Smith",32),newUser(3,"Steve","Johnson",57
文章目录01.Nginx简介02.正向代理和反向代理03.Nginx和Apache、Tomcat之间的不同点04.Nginx的优点05.Nginx常用的功能特性06.Nginx下载07.Nginx安装1.源码安装前的环境准备2.Nginx源码简单安装方式3.Nginxyum安装方式4.Nginx源码复杂安装方式08.Nginx目录结构分析09.Nginx服务器启动和停止命令1.信号控制Nginx服务器的启动和停止2.命令行控制Nginx服务器的启动和停止10.Nginx服务器版本的升级和新增模块1.环境准备2.使用Nginx服务信号进行升级3.使用Nginx安装目录的make命令完成升级01.
一、“分布式”与“集群”的解释: 分布式:把一个囊肿的系统分成无数个单独可运行的功能模块 集群:把相同的项目复制进行多次部署(可以是一台服务器多次部署,例如使用8080部署一个,8081部署一个,也可以是a服务器部署一个,b服务器上部署一个,使用nginx类似的软件做负载均衡并轮询转发)二、为什么要用分布式? 首先是项目工程无节制的变得臃肿庞大,今天增加一个业务,明天扩展一个模块,系统复杂度增加,大几十万行代码,几十个开发人员,service层,dao层代码大量被copy使用,经常有各种代码合并冲突要处理,非常耗时间。经常是我改动了自己的代码,但别人调用了我的接口,导
dc3windows本地搭建步骤:必要软件环境进入原网页#务必保证至少需要给docker分配:1核CPU以及4G以上的运行内存!JDK:推荐使用OracleJDK1.8或者OpenJDK8,理论来说其他版本也行;Maven:推荐使用Maven3.8,理论来说其他版本也行;IDE:IntelliJIDEA或者Eclipse,理论来说其他JavaIDE也行;Docker:需要提供docker和docker-compose指令,至少需要给docker分配4G的运行内存,建议配置国内镜像加速,下载镜像速度会快一些。1管理员权限改hosts:#AddedbyDC3127.0.0.1dc3-mysql
环境:springboot.2.4.12+RabbitMQ3.7.4什么是最大努力通知这是一个充值的案例图片交互流程:1、账户系统调用充值系统接口。2、充值系统完成支付向账户系统发起充值结果通知若通知失败,则充值系统按策略进行重复通知。3、账户系统接收到充值结果通知修改充值状态。4、账户系统未接收到通知会主动调用充值系统的接口查询充值结果。通过上边的例子我们总结最大努力通知方案的目标:目标:发起通知方通过一定的机制最大努力将业务处理结果通知到接收方。具体包括:1、有一定的消息重复通知机制。因为接收通知方可能没有接收到通知,此时要有一定的机制对消息重复通知。2、消息校对机制。如果尽最大努力也没有
HDFS分布式存储sparkstormHBase分布式结构masterslavenamenodeclient负责文件的拆分128MB3份datanodeMapReduce分布式计算离线计算2.X之前速度比较慢对比spark编程思想Map分Reduce合hadoopstreamingMrjobYarn资源管理cpu内存MapReducespark分布式计算RMNMAM社区版CDH什么是Hive基于Hadoop数据保存到HDFS数据仓库工具结构化的数据映射为一张数据库表01,张三,8902,李四,9103,赵武,92HQL查询功能(HiveSQL)本质把HQL翻译成MapReduce降低使用had